Why is the mitochondria important in cellular respiration?

Biology
1 answer:
kodGreya [7K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Mitochondria have an important role in cellular respiration through the production of ATP, using chemical energy found in glucose and other nutrients. Mitochondria are also responsible for generating clusters of iron and sulfur, which are important cofactors of many enzymes.
